Recent advances in chemical upcycling of plastic waste: microwave-assisted heating and heterogeneous catalysis

Summary

Researchers review how microwave-assisted heterogeneous catalysis can rapidly and energy-efficiently convert waste plastics into fuels, monomers, and commodity chemicals, offering a promising chemical upcycling pathway to recover value from plastic waste.

Microwave-assisted heterogeneous catalysis enables rapid, energy efficient conversion of waste plastics to value-added fuels, monomers and commodity chemicals.
